Freighters are subject to certain restrictions: Assembled containers and assembled secure containers cannot be put in a freighter's cargo hold, so that pilots can't use containers to increase freighters' cargo capacity in the same way that they're used to increase the capacity of [[Industrial|industrials]]. The Retribution patch removed the previously existing restriction on jetcans.

The four Tech 1 freighters are good for carrying very large amounts of cargo in high security space. They align and warp too slowly to be safely used in lowsec or nullsec. Freighters are very tough, but they are definitely ''not'' immune to suicide ganking -- organised and prepared groups of gankers can and do kill freighters.
